    Spirit Airlines turns honest mistakes into a profit center…read more I've flown a lot. I understand low-cost carriers, fine print, and trade-offs. What I don't accept is a business model that appears designed to trap customers into accidental purchases and then stonewall them when they immediately try to fix an obvious mistake. On January 26, 2026, I went to Spirit's website to buy a seat and a checked bag. I believed I was purchasing a $69.95 Savers Club seat option. Instead, Spirit quietly charged me for: A seat ($47) A checked bag ($69) A Spirit Savers Club membership ($69.95) This was clearly an error, identified within minutes of purchase. What followed was one of the worst customer service experiences I've ever had. I immediately called Spirit: First call: 17 minutes and 39 seconds on hold, then disconnected. Second call: 18 more minutes, only to be told the agent couldn't help and transferred me again. When I finally reached a representative, I was told I was ineligible for a refund because I had supposedly "used" the Savers Club membership... on the same transaction in which it was mistakenly purchased. Let that sink in. I calmly proposed the most reasonable solution imaginable: Refund the seat, bag, and membership, remove them from my reservation, and I'll immediately repurchase the seat and bag at full price. Spirit refused. Repeatedly. Instead, they tried to push bonus miles and a small credit--completely useless to me, since my employer pays for my travel and does not reimburse memberships. I explained this clearly. More than once. It didn't matter. For over eight minutes, the agent refused to help while I remained polite and cooperative. At one point, I informed them I was recording the call. The behavior didn't improve. This wasn't about policy. This wasn't about fairness. This was about extracting $69.95 from a customer who caught a mistake immediately and tried to resolve it in good faith. Spirit Airlines has mastered the art of hiding behind "policy" to justify behavior that would never fly (pun intended) at a customer-centric company. The experience left me with the clear impression that confusion isn't a bug in their system -- it's a feature. If you value transparency, basic fairness, or customer service that treats you like a human being instead of a revenue opportunity, think very carefully before booking with Spirit Airlines. I certainly will.
